A kitchen's layout determines its speed, its labor costs, and its safety record. Staff moving 20 extra feet per order costs real money — a poor layout adds miles of walking every shift and creates collision points in service. Design the flow first; pick equipment second.

The Six Work Zones

  • Receiving — delivery entrance with scales, space to check invoices, and a clear path to storage

  • Dry and Cold Storage — close to receiving and prep, away from heat sources

  • Prep — between storage and cooking, with tables, sinks, and small equipment

  • Cooking Line — ranges, ovens, fryers, and hoods arranged in the order food is finished

  • Plating and Pass — the hot window where plates are assembled and picked up

  • Dish and Warewashing — at the back, separated from food flow to prevent cross-contamination

The Flow Rule

Food should move in one direction: receiving → storage → prep → cooking → plating → service. Returning traffic — staff walking against the food flow — causes collisions, spills, and contamination. Dish returns travel the opposite edge of the kitchen, keeping soiled items away from food paths.

Key Dimensions That Matter

  • Aisles: Main aisles need 36–48 inches; equipment aisles with drawers open require 44–60 inches. Under 36 inches, staff cannot pass safely with hot items.

  • Cooking Line Depth: 4–6 feet of working space in front of the line; 3 feet minimum behind equipment for service access.

  • Work Triangles: Group each workstation's sink, prep surface, and equipment within arm's reach — a stretched triangle costs steps on every order.

Hot and Cold Zoning

Separate heat-producing equipment (ovens, fryers, steamers, dishwashers) from cold storage and prep. Adjacent heat forces refrigeration compressors to work harder and shortens food holding times. A good design clusters hot equipment under one hood run — cheaper to vent, easier to cool.

Common Design Mistakes to Avoid

  • Undersized aisles — the #1 safety problem; never below 36 inches

  • Storage far from prep — every restock trip wastes minutes and labor

  • Dish station beside food prep — cross-contamination risk that fails inspections

  • No dedicated hand sink in each zone — code violation and a hygiene risk

  • Equipment bought before layout — a great range with no hood clearance is a fire hazard, not an asset

FAQ

  1. What is the standard aisle width in a commercial kitchen? Main aisles need 36–48 inches minimum. Equipment aisles with open drawers or doors require 44–60 inches for safe access.

  2. What are the main zones in a commercial kitchen layout? Receiving, dry and cold storage, prep, cooking, plating/pass, and dishwashing — arranged so food flows one direction from delivery to service.

  3. How do I design an efficient commercial kitchen workflow? Route food one way (receiving → storage → prep → cooking → plating), cluster hot equipment under one hood, group each workstation's tools within reach, and keep dishwashing isolated from food paths.
